The mailman surprised me today with 2 creations from Andrew Takach. We had traded my wood and Elk antler for his knives and he sent me a drawknife for taking the bark off the hiking sticks that I make. It's just the right size for small rounds of saplings.
I had given him a rough outline of a Elk handled hunter I wanted. I selected the antler because of a great handfeel. The result is this beauty in forged 1084 steel 3/16" thick with stainless guard and buttcap. The hamon is very pronounced and crisp. The fit and finish are topnotch. Andrew is a very talented knifemaker and I'm glad we traded!
